What does the acronym GIST stand for?

The acronym GIST represents a communication framework that focuses on effective customer interaction, particularly in sales and service contexts. The components of Greet, Inquire, Suggest, and Thank provide a structured approach to engaging with clients.

  • Greet emphasizes the importance of making a positive first impression and establishing rapport. A friendly greeting can set a welcoming tone for the conversation.
  • Inquire involves asking questions to understand the client's needs, preferences, and concerns. This step is crucial for tailored communication and ensuring the client feels heard.

  • Suggest pertains to offering informed recommendations based on the information gathered during the inquiry. This shows the client that their needs are being prioritized.

  • Thank reinforces good customer service by expressing appreciation for the client's time and trust. Gratitude helps build a positive relationship and encourages future interactions.

This method is effective for strengthening customer relationships, which is essential for successful business communications. It also encourages a more conversational and engaging atmosphere, making it easier to connect with the customer and facilitate positive exchanges.
